Q: Is 41,200,264 a Prime Number?
A: No, 41,200,264 is not a prime number.
A prime number is a natural number, greater than one, that can only be divided by 1 and itself.
The number 41200264 can be evenly divided by 1 2 4 7 8 14 28 56 735,719 1,471,438 2,942,876 5,150,033 5,885,752 10,300,066 20,600,132 and 41,200,264, with no remainder.
Since 41,200,264 cannot be divided by just 1 and 41,200,264, it is not a prime number.
